WebMay 31, 2024 · What is considered a small airport? Small hub primary – airports with 0.05 to 0.25% of the country’s annual passenger boardings. Medium hub primary – airports handling 0.25 to 1% of the country’s annual passenger boardings. Large hub primary – airports handling over 1% of the country’s annual passenger boardings. WebPrimary Surface: A surface longitudinally centered on a runway. When the runway has a specially prepared hard surface, the primary surface extends 200 feet beyond either end of the that runway; but when the runway has no specially prepared surface, or planned hard surface, the primary surface ends at the physical ends of the runway. Primary airports are further subcategorized based on the number of passenger boardings as a fraction of the national total.
